Chemical & Physical Properties

[ Density]:
1.087

[ Boiling Point ]:
191.3ºC at 760 mmHg 68ºC (2 mmHg)

[ Molecular Formula ]:
C6H9NO3

[ Molecular Weight ]:
143.14100

[ Flash Point ]:
76.3ºC

[ Exact Mass ]:
143.05800

[ PSA ]:
55.73000

[ LogP ]:
0.27540

[ Index of Refraction ]:
1.4275-1.4295

[ Storage condition ]:
0-6°C

[ Water Solubility ]:
Not miscible with water.
